Randall-Reilly purchases Kona Communications.


Randall-Reilly Communications (Birmingham, AL), a company whose Truck Stop Publishing Division includes "Truckers News," "Overdrive (processor) Overdrive - An Intel Pentium processor which fits into a socket designed to accomodate an Intel 486, or into a special upgrade socket on the motherboard. ," "Owner/Operator," "Transportista" (formerly "Truckers News en Espanol") and "Commercial Carrier Journal," has acquired the assets of Kona Communications (Deerfield, IL), the publisher of "Truck Parts & Services" and "Successful Dealer" magazines, and the annual "Aftermarket Aftermarket

 Buyers' Guide & Directory." No terms of the deal were given.

"Truck Parts & Service" was launched in 1966 and is published 12 times a year for a controlled circulation of 26,400 presidents, company owners, managers, sales managers sales manager ngerente m/f de ventas

 and related professionals in the trucking industry.  equipment distributors, service operators, truck and trailer dealers, and truck stops. Troubleshooting is often a process of elimination - eliminating potential causes of a problem. , aftermarket products, sales, maintenance, and equipment.

"Successful Dealer" is published six times a year for a controlled circulation of 23,000 truck dealers, truck leasing and rental company executives, truck body/equipment dealers and other related industry professionals. Launched in 1978, the magazine covers ongoing profit opportunities, diagnostic repair procedures, training employees, technology advances, managing departments and operations, sales and marketing, leasing, and managing multiple locations.

The acquired publications are "leaders in the markets they serve," Randall-Reilly President/CEO Mike Reilly Michael Eugene Reilly (born July 2 1949 in Sioux City, Iowa) is an umpire in Major League Baseball who has worked in the American League from 1978 to 1999 and throughout both major leagues since 2000.  said in a statement, "making them an excellent fit with our existing publications." The deal "furthers our goal of offering trucking industry suppliers a property to meet each of their marketing needs." Besides its Truck Stop Division, Randall-Reilly properties also include "Equipment World," "Total Landscape Care" and "Top Bid" magazines, references and Equipment Data Associates.
